A powder has a mass of 40.0g. When the powder is added to 30.0mL of water, the total volume is 45.0mL. What is the density of the powder

density = mass/volume
Assuming that the powder doesn't dissolve and that all of it is submerged (none floats), d = 40/15 = ? g/mL
